el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Rompecabezas de Bitcoin, Medio millón USD en premios


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ación C/C++ (Moderadores: Eternal Idol, Littlehorse, K-YreX)
| | |-+  MiBot. Robot Simulator
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: MiBot. Robot Simulator  (Leído 1,566 veces)
MiBean Projects

Desconectado Desconectado

Mensajes: 7


Ver Perfil WWW
MiBot. Robot Simulator
« en: 27 Febrero 2014, 15:54 pm »

Hola a todos amigas y amigos, les dejo los avances y objetivos de uno de mis nuevos proyectos. Lo posteo en esta categoría por que lo estoy desarrollando en C++ y un poco más delante lo compartiré con ustedes, incluyendo ejecutable y código.

El programa funcionará en Windows y Linux.

MiBot es una aplicación que consta de un simulador de robot para probar instrucciones simples y media-avanzadas como introducción a la programación para estudiantes de cómputo, pues aunque no sea un lenguaje de programación real, provee bases fuertes sobre lo que significa diseñar un programa.


Las limitaciones son bastante marcadas, pues no se pueden crear ni variables, crear objetos, etc. Lo que provoca en los nuevos programadores el desarrollo de habilidades que le permitan resolver diferentes problemas con muy pocos recursos.


Editor de mapas
Como su nombre lo indica, se usa para editar el mapa en el que MiBot puede desplazarse y realizar algunas actividades, estos mapas se pueden guardar en un archivo de texto para luego poder ser abiertos de nuevo.

En este editor se puede interactuar directamente con el mapa desde el mouse, pudiendo agregar o eliminar algunos objetos con los que MiBot puede interactuar.

Interprete
Este programa simplemente como su nombre lo indica interpreta y va realizando las instrucciones que se agreguen en el documento principal. Estas instrucciones las va realizando MiBot hasta llegar al fin.

Entre las funciones que incluye MiBot se encuentra: tirar objeto, recoger, destruir, desplazarse, girar (sólo a la izquierda), etc.

¿Por qué solo gira a la izquierda?
Esto es realmente a propósito, con el fin de necesitar crear una función que incluya un ciclo para girar repetidas veces a la izquierda hasta haber girado 270 grados, que sería lo equivalente  a haber girado a la derecha.

Actualmente se encuentra en fase de desarrollo, para dirigirte al hilo oficial del proyecto da clic aquí.
http://foro.mibean.tk/viewtopic.php?f=18&t=8


En línea

Lo más complicado en el desarrollo de software es usar la lógica correctamente, esto también es lo que lo hace interesante.

www.mibean.tk
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Flight simulator 2000
Juegos y Consolas
Lord_bad 1 2,793 Último mensaje 14 Noviembre 2004, 03:25 am
por PhoEniX89
flight simulator parche español??
Juegos y Consolas
MiAUS1 0 2,207 Último mensaje 15 Junio 2007, 05:04 am
por MiAUS1
Una 9600GT para Flight Simulator X ?
Juegos y Consolas
Odyssea 6 2,585 Último mensaje 10 Abril 2008, 19:49 pm
por lu8emw
Flight simulator X,
Juegos y Consolas
softdates 7 5,071 Último mensaje 4 Octubre 2008, 01:15 am
por softdates
Probando PIC Simulator IDE
Electrónica
Meta 1 3,651 Último mensaje 14 Marzo 2014, 04:50 am
por engel lex
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ines